Transaction

ff7e58c66ee06cd11eb328f31792e00e8a4a02fc03e33f5954da4cef15359256
442,847 confirmations
Timestamp
1512785815
Block498,321
Fee188,549 sats
Fee rate389.6 sats/vB
view on mempool.space

Inputs & Outputs